Okay, for all of you hesitant game buyers out there looking for the perfect RTS game to buy for Christmas, Empire Earth is it. I have been playing it for a few weeks, and the scope of gameplay is immense. From Stone Age to Nano Age; from Swordsmen to Ultra-Cybers; from Stone Circles, to massive Glass Cathedrals -- This game has it all. The units are varied and can span centuries. And, the Computer A.I. is smart as hell. Even on the easiest setting, a full epoch game can take quite a few hours.

But, the best part is not even listed in these reasons above. It is the Multiplayer. If you like games that are involving and massive, this is it. Rikus_Khan and I played a 2 player vs. 3 computer player game from 5:00 p.m. on Saturday night till 2:30 a.m. Sunday morning. And even up till near the end (the last couple of hours), the computer players were pushing through defenses to claim ground in our area. The computer is even smart enough to figure what defenses are weak and start pumping out units to take advantage of it. For example, I left a small gap in my air defenses, so instead of trying to push through my lines, two of the computer players started airlifting units behind my defenses and attacking my towns. Once, I squashed this approach and put up defenses, the computer players stopped producing airlift choppers.
